A kind of synthesis process and device of retarded polycarboxylate water reducing agent
A technology of retarded polycarboxylic acid and synthesis process, applied in the field of concrete water reducing agent preparation, can solve the problems of inability to add material, complicated feeding system, precipitation, etc., and achieve the effect of preventing product precipitation

Embodiment 1
[0096] (1) Preparation of raw materials:
[0097] Preparation of unsaturated polyether macromonomer A: Weigh 800Kg (according to 50 parts) allyl alcohol polyoxyethylene ether (APEG, number average molecular weight 1500-2400) and 800Kg (according to 50 parts) polyethylene glycol mono Methyl ether (MPEG, number average molecular weight 1500-2400), waiting for standby;
[0098] Preparation of starch and its modified starch monomer C: Weigh 5 parts of ordinary corn starch, 5 parts of gelatinized starch and 5 parts of sulfonated starch for subsequent use;
[0099] Preparation of preservative F: Weigh 0.05 part of dimethyl fumarate and put it in a beaker for later use;
[0100] The liquid dispensing in the 1-8# batching storage tanks in the liquid-phase batching storage tank group 2 is as follows:
